I got kind of desperate since I need to drive to work in the morning. I pretty much cut out all of the saab harness and hooked up wires directly to the poles on the motors. I was then able to move the seat into a fairly ok position by attaching a wire to the + terminal on the car battery and another wire to a chassis ground and switching the connections back and forth. I say fairly ok since I missed one of the wires when I had the seat out (the one that controls front up and down) and don't have time to remove and reboot tonight. The replacement seat ecu for mid-year 1996 car is hard to find and very costly. I am going to try to locate a manual seat and get rid of the wiring mess.
